The North America biosolids market size is anticipated to expand at a significant CAGR during the forecast period 2021–2028. Growth of the market is attributed to increasing demand for eco-friendly fertilizers, reduction in fertilizers costs, and rising cattle farming activities.
The biosolids are solid organic substance obtained from a sewage treatment method and utilized as fertilizer that can be used as a soil conditioner. When it is processed and treated, it can be recycled and used as fertilizer to stimulate plant growth and maintain and improve productivity of soils.

The agriculture land application segment is expected to grow at a rapid pace
Based on applications, the North America biosolids market is segregated into energy recovery - energy production, agriculture land application, and non-agricultural land application. The energy recovery- energy production segment is sub-segmented into commercial uses, gasification, heat generation, and incineration, and oil and cement production. The agriculture land application segment is further bifurcated into soil conditioner and fertilizer for human crop production. The non-agricultural land application segment is sub-segmented into domestic use, recreational fields, and landscaping, reclaiming mining sites, forest crops, and land reclamation. The agriculture land application accounts for a key share of the market. Growth of the market is attributed to augmenting the demand for animal crop production and stringent government emission law. However, the non-agricultural land application is anticipated to expand at a rapid pace during the forecast period due to factors such as increasing horticulture & farming practices and technological advancement in biosolids.
The class A EQ segment accounts for a major share of the market
On the basis of types, the North America biosolids market is fragmented into class A EQ, class A, and class B. The class A EQ segment accounts for a major share of the market. Growth of the market is attributed to rising food demand and increasing consumption of biosolids across region. The class A segment is anticipated to expand at a rapid pace during the forecast period due to factors such as high nutritional value of biosolids and rising need for replacement for chemical fertilizers.
The liquid segment accounts for a significant share of the market
Based on forms, the North America biosolids market is segregated into liquid, pellet, and cake. The liquid segment accounts for a significant share of the market. Growth of the market is attributed to increasing demand for high yield crop and increase in per capita income. The pellet segment is anticipated to expand at a rapid pace during the forecast period due to factors such as increasing demand for organic fertilizers and growing cattle farming activities.
